Güllaç with plenty of walnuts and a small amount of pistachios contains 175 calories per 100 g. A 100 g serving also provides 25.5 g of carbohydrates, 4.2 g of protein, and 6.2 g of fat.
This güllaç is compatible with Mediterranean, vegetarian, flexitarian, and omnivore diets. Its glycemic index is 65, and it contains dairy and tree nuts.
